Josh Maja among six players West Brom fans want to see depart in brutal admission

West Brom fans have called on the Baggies and Ryan Mason not to hand out new deals to any of the six players who are currently out of contract in the summer.

With West Brom currently set for another mediocre season, things may need to change rapidly if the Baggies are to return to the Premier League.

Mason’s future is already uncertain at The Hawthorns, with their win over Oxford United on the weekend cooling demands for him to be sacked.

However, the fans are not just unhappy with the manager and are more than willing to see the back of several players in the summer, including Josh Maja.

West Brom fans do not want to see Josh Maja’s contract renewed

Maja has had a difficult return to the pitch since his injury at West Brom.

The Baggies striker has only found the net once this season, which has contributed to the Black Country club’s poor return up top.

As a result, with his contract expiring in the summer, many fans have taken to X to argue that the attacker should not be given a new deal.

On top of this, fans also called for the release of Daryl Dike, Karlan Grant, Jed Wallace, Joe Wildsmith and Ousmane Diakite.

However, others would be willing to see Maja or Diakite given at least another season, with West Brom also holding a one-year extension option for the latter star.

How bad has Maja been this season?

While it must be remembered that Maja has only just come back from an injury at West Brom, the striker has been extremely poor this season.

According to Fotmob on 13 November, the attackers’ stats up top are horrendous, with Maja only managing 1.83 shots per 90 minutes.

Josh Maja’s Championship stats this seasonPer 90 minutes
Goals 0.23
xG0.37
Shots 1.83
Shots on target 0.46
Chances created 1.15
Assists 0.00
Expected assists 0.03
Maja has been poor so far this season

Therefore, a stark improvement will be needed if he is to convince Mason that he deserves a new deal.

If not, he will surely be released in the summer, or could even be sold in the upcoming January transfer window.
